OstrichLand USA is a one-of-a-kind roadside attraction nestled between Solvang and Buellton in the beautiful Santa Ynez Valley. Spread across 32 acres, this fun ranch is home to over 100 giant birds—ostriches and emus!
Los Olivos is a picture-perfect country town nestled in the heart of the Santa Ynez Valley. Spend a leisurely afternoon strolling through its quaint downtown, where you’ll find boutique wine tasting rooms, unique shops, and gourmet bites around every corner.
Solvang is a storybook Danish village known for its windmills, half-timbered architecture, and old-world charm. Take a stroll through town to enjoy cozy bakeries (must try the aableskivers!), boutique shopping, wine tasting rooms, and a little European magic right in the Santa Ynez Valley.
Cold Spring Tavern is a one-of-a-kind slice of Old West charm tucked in the wooded San Marcos Pass between Santa Barbara and Santa Ynez. Originally a stagecoach stop dating back to the 1860s, this rustic roadhouse has been family-run since 1941 and still feels like stepping into a living history exhibit.
